Cleanup and Disinfection
Sewage cleanup entails the removal of contaminated water and waste materials. It involves utilizing specialized equipment and protective gear to ensure the safety of both the property and occupants.
Disinfection follows the cleanup process to eliminate harmful bacteria and pathogens. It involves the application of EPA-approved disinfectants to prevent the spread of infection and restore the property to a sanitary condition.
Effects of Sewage Contamination
Sewage contamination poses significant health risks to individuals exposed to it. It can cause a range of illnesses, including gastroenteritis, dysentery, and skin and eye infections.
How Long Does Sewage Stay Toxic?
The toxicity of sewage depends on several factors, such as the type of bacteria present and the environmental conditions.
- In favorable conditions, bacteria can survive in sewage for weeks to months.
- However, exposure to sunlight and drying can significantly reduce bacterial growth and virulence.
